Totally Science GitLab

Totally Science GitLab – Benefits of Integrating In 2024

In the realm of scientific research and collaboration, the integration of robust version control systems like GitLab has become increasingly indispensable.

GitLab, a web-based Git repository manager, offers a comprehensive suite of features tailored not only for software development but also for scientific workflows.

By marrying the principles of reproducibility, collaboration, and version control, GitLab has emerged as a powerful tool for advancing scientific endeavors.

What is Science in GitLab?

When we talk about “totally science GitLab,” we’re essentially referring to the adaptation and utilization of GitLab within scientific domains.

Science in GitLab encompasses the application of GitLab’s version control, project management, and collaboration features to scientific workflows.

source:Tecno Krafter

This involves using GitLab to track changes in research code, datasets, and documentation, facilitating collaboration among researchers, ensuring the reproducibility of results, and streamlining project management tasks.

Benefits of Integrating Science with GitLab

Integrating GitLab into scientific workflows offers numerous benefits. Firstly, it enhances version control, allowing researchers to track changes to their code and data, thereby ensuring transparency and reproducibility.

Also read :Choice Home Warranty George Foreman

Secondly, GitLab’s collaboration features enable seamless teamwork, facilitating code review, feedback, and knowledge sharing among researchers.

Thirdly, GitLab’s project management capabilities aid in organizing tasks, milestones, and issues, thereby enhancing productivity and efficiency in research projects.

Implementing Science in GitLab

Implementing science in GitLab involves adapting the platform to suit the unique requirements of scientific research projects.

This may include configuring project structures, defining access controls, and establishing workflows tailored to specific research methodologies.

Furthermore, organizations can integrate GitLab with complementary tools and services to create comprehensive scientific computing environments.

For instance, they can utilize GitLab’s integration with Jupyter notebooks to enable interactive data analysis or incorporate Docker containers for reproducible computational environments.

By customizing GitLab instances to align with scientific workflows, researchers can streamline collaboration, enhance reproducibility, and accelerate the pace of scientific discovery.

Tools and Features for Scientific Workflows

Totally Science GitLab offers a range of tools and features tailored to support scientific workflows.

These include Git repositories for version control, issue tracking for managing tasks and milestones, wikis for documenting research processes, and CI/CD pipelines for automating testing and deployment.

source:Wendy Waldman

Additionally, GitLab provides integrations with popular scientific computing tools such as RStudio, MATLAB, and Python libraries like NumPy and Pandas.

Researchers can leverage these tools within GitLab’s unified platform to streamline their workflow, from code development and experimentation to publication and dissemination of results.

Collaboration and Sharing in Scientific Projects

One of the key strengths of Totally Science GitLab lies in its ability to facilitate collaboration and sharing in scientific projects.

Researchers can utilize features such as merge requests, code reviews, and discussions to collaborate on code development and review.

Moreover, GitLab’s visibility settings enable researchers to control access to their projects and data, ensuring appropriate levels of privacy and security.

GitLab’s permissions model allows administrators to define fine-grained access controls, ensuring that only authorized individuals have access to sensitive research data.

Additionally, GitLab’s built-in communication tools, such as issue boards and real-time chat, foster seamless collaboration among geographically distributed research teams.

Security and Compliance Measures

Security and compliance are paramount in scientific research, especially when dealing with sensitive data or proprietary algorithms.

Totally Science GitLab offers robust security features such as access controls, authentication mechanisms, and encryption protocols to safeguard research assets.

Also read : Chillwithkira Ticket Show

Furthermore, GitLab enables organizations to enforce compliance with regulatory requirements such as GDPR and HIPAA through configurable policies and audit logs.

By adhering to industry best practices for security and compliance, researchers can mitigate risks associated with data breaches and ensure the integrity and confidentiality of their research data.

Future Trends in Science with GitLab

As scientific research becomes increasingly reliant on digital tools and collaboration platforms, the role of GitLab is poised to expand further.

Future trends may include deeper integrations with specialized scientific software, enhanced support for reproducible research practices, and advancements in AI-driven analytics for code and data repositories.

source:Unite.AI

Additionally, Totally Science GitLab community-driven development model ensures ongoing innovation and adaptation to emerging needs in the scientific community.

With its flexible architecture and extensible framework, GitLab is well-positioned to drive innovation and collaboration in scientific research across diverse domains.

Conclusion

In conclusion, “Totally Science GitLab” represents a paradigm shift in how researchers collaborate, manage, and disseminate their work.

By leveraging GitLab’s powerful suite of tools and features, scientists can enhance the transparency, efficiency, and reproducibility of their research endeavors.

Also read : History and Evolution of FTMÇ In 2024

As GitLab continues to evolve and adapt to the needs of the scientific community, it stands poised to play an increasingly vital role in driving innovation and discovery across various scientific domains.

By embracing GitLab as a central platform for scientific collaboration and experimentation, researchers can accelerate the pace of scientific discovery and unlock new insights into the natural world.

FAQs 

What makes Totally Science GitLab different from regular GitLab?

Totally Science GitLab is tailored specifically for scientific research, offering specialized tools and features to support collaboration, reproducibility, and data management in scientific workflows.

How does Totally Science GitLab ensure data security for sensitive research projects?

Totally Science GitLab employs robust security measures such as access controls, encryption protocols, and compliance features to safeguard sensitive research data and ensure regulatory compliance.

Can Totally Science GitLab integrate with other scientific computing tools and platforms?

Yes, Totally Science GitLab offers seamless integration with popular scientific computing tools and platforms like Jupyter notebooks, RStudio, MATLAB, and Docker containers, enhancing its versatility and utility in scientific research.

What role does Continuous Integration/Continuous Deployment (CI/CD) play in Totally Science GitLab?

CI/CD in Totally Science GitLab automates testing, validation, and deployment processes, ensuring code quality, reproducibility, and efficiency in scientific software development and deployment.

How does Totally Science GitLab support reproducible research practices?

Totally Science GitLab provides version control, issue tracking, and documentation features that enable researchers to capture, track, and share all aspects of their research workflow, enhancing transparency and reproducibility.

Is Totally Science GitLab suitable for interdisciplinary research projects?

Absolutely, Totally Science GitLab fosters collaboration and communication among researchers from diverse disciplines, providing a unified platform for sharing ideas, code, and data across interdisciplinary teams.

Can Totally Science GitLab be used for academic publishing and collaboration with external partners?

Yes, Totally Science GitLab offers features for publishing research findings, collaborating with external partners, and sharing data and code openly, facilitating academic collaboration and dissemination of research outcomes.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*